1. Choose the Right Trucker Hat:

The first step to styling trucker hats is selecting the right one that complements your personal style and face shape. Consider the following factors when choosing a trucker hat:

  • Color: Opt for colors that match or contrast your outfit. Neutral colors like black, white, and navy are versatile and easy to pair with different clothing items. Bold colors like red, yellow, and blue can add a pop of color to your look.
  • Design: Trucker hats come in various designs, from classic mesh trucker hats to more intricate ones with embroidery, patches, or graphics. Choose a design that reflects your personality and style preferences.
  • Fit: Ensure the trucker hat fits snugly but comfortably on your head. An ill-fitting hat can ruin the overall look and make you feel uncomfortable.

7. Maintain Your Trucker Hat:

To keep your trucker hat looking fresh and stylish, follow these maintenance tips:

  • Hand Wash: Hand wash your trucker hat in cold water with a mild detergent. Avoid using harsh chemicals or bleach.
  • Air Dry: Allow your trucker hat to air dry naturally. Avoid putting it in the dryer, as the heat can damage the material.
  • Store Properly: Store your trucker hat in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
